  • What to Know About Colorado City, Arizona

  • Colorado City is a town located in Mohave County, Arizona, near the Utah border. Originally settled in the late 19th century by members of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ints (LDS), the town was initially known as Short Creek. It was later renamed Colorado City in honor of the nearby Colorado River.

  • The town has a unique history closely tied to the Fundamentalist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-Day Saints (FLDS), a sect that split from the mainstream LDS church in the early 20th century. Colorado City became a stronghold for the FLDS community, which practices polygamy and holds traditional beliefs that set them apart from mainstream society.

  • Demographically, Colorado City has a population that is predominantly FLDS members, who adhere to a strict religious and social structure. The town has a unique cultural identity shaped by the FLDS community's beliefs and practices.

  • One of the most distinctive characteristics of Colorado City is its architectural style, with many homes and buildings reflecting a traditional, conservative aesthetic favored by the FLDS community. The town's close-knit community and strong religious influence also contribute to its distinct character.

  • In recent years, Colorado City has faced legal challenges and controversies related to allegations of abuse and misconduct within the FLDS community. Efforts have been made to address these issues and improve the town's governance and social services.

  • Overall, Colorado City remains a fascinating and complex town with a rich history, unique demographics, and distinctive cultural characteristics shaped by its ties to the FLDS community.

  • Finding Affordable Car Insurance in Colorado City, Arizona

  • Finding affordable car insurance in Colorado City, Arizona, can be a challenging task, but with some strategic tips, you can save money on your premiums. Here are some tips to help you find affordable car insurance in Colorado City:

  • 1. Compare Quotes: One of the most effective ways to find affordable car insurance is to compare quotes from multiple insurance providers. This will help you identify the best rates available in Colorado City.

  • 2. Look for Discounts: Many insurance companies offer discounts for various reasons, such as being a safe driver, bundling multiple policies, having a good credit score, or being a member of certain organizations. Make sure to ask about available discounts when getting quotes.

  • 3. Choose a Higher Deductible: Increasing your deductible can lower your premium costs. Just make sure you can afford to pay the higher deductible in case of an accident.

  • 4. Drive Safely: Maintaining a clean driving record can help you qualify for lower insurance rates. Avoid accidents and traffic violations to keep your premiums down.

  • 5. Consider Usage-Based Insurance: Some insurance companies offer usage-based insurance programs that track your driving habits and adjust your rates accordingly. If you are a safe driver, this could potentially save you money.

  • 6. Opt for a Car with Lower Insurance Costs: Before purchasing a new car, consider how much it will cost to insure. Cars with high safety ratings and lower theft rates typically have lower insurance premiums.

  • 7. Ask About Special Programs: Some insurance companies offer special programs for certain demographics, such as students, seniors, or military personnel. Inquire about any programs that may apply to you.

  • 8. Maintain Good Credit: In many states, including Arizona, insurance companies use credit scores to determine rates. Maintaining a good credit score can help you secure lower insurance premiums.

  • 9. Consider Local Insurance Companies: While national insurance companies may offer competitive rates, don't overlook local insurance providers in Colorado City. They may offer personalized service and more affordable options.

  • By following these tips and strategies, you can increase your chances of finding affordable car insurance in Colorado City, Arizona. Remember to review your policy regularly and make adjustments as needed to ensure you are getting the best rates possible.
